CENTER RITES ARE SATURDAY
Mrs. Emma K. Center, 64, of 508 North Emporia, died Thursday morning in a local hospital after a long illness.
She was born in Linn, Mo., and came to Wichita from Oklahoma City 32 years ago. She was a member of St. Mary's Cathedral.
She is survived by her husband, Edwin B. Center, Sr., and a son, Edwin, Jr., of the home; eight sisters, Mrs. Kate Stieferman of Oklahoma City, Mary Liberton, Mrs. Betty Otto, Mrs. Anna Felder, Mrs. Louise Miller and Mrs. Lena McNulty, all of Hennessey, Oklahoma, Mrs. Minnie comerford of Blackwell, Oklahoma, and Mrs. Cecilia Bruner of 601 South Poplar; and a brother John Liberton of Ponca City, Oklahoma.
Funeral services and burial will be held Saturday morning at Hennessey, and Flanagan-Bourman Mortuary is in charge of local arrangements.

UNKNOWN NEWSPAPER
MRS. EMMA K. CENTER SUCCUMBS IN HOSPITAL
Mrs. Emma K. Center, aged 64, of 508 North Emporia, died Thursday morning in St. Francis hospital after a long illness.
She was born in Linn, Mo., and came to Wichita from Oklahoma City 32 years ago. She was a member of St. Mary's Cathedral.
She is survived by her husband, Edwin B. Center, Sr., and a son, Edwin, Jr., of the home; eight sisters, Mrs. Kate Stieferman of Oklahoma City, Mary Liberton, Mrs. Betty Otto, Mrs. Anna Felder, Mrs. Louise Miller and Mrs. Lena McNulty, all of Hennessey, Oklahoma, Mrs. Minnie comerford of Blackwell, Oklahoma, and Mrs. Cecilia Bruner of 601 South Poplar; and a brother John Liberton of Ponca City, Oklahoma.
The body will be taken to Hennessey Friday by Flanagan-Bourman mortuary for services and burial there Saturday morning.
OBITUARY RECORD
Death certificates filed by attending physicians in the office of the city clerk as a matter of public record on September 22:
Emma K. Center, 64, of 508 North Emporia, a housewife, died September 22 of carcinoma.
